Description
Opening of the 2010-2011 school year in Planning Districts 5 and 12. Authorizes the school boards in Planning Districts 5 and 12, which includes Alleghany County, Botetourt County, Craig County, Roanoke County, City of Covington, City of Roanoke, City of Salem, Pittsylvania County, Martinsville City, Henry County, Franklin County, Patrick County, and Danville City, to set the opening of the 2010-2011 school year so that the first day students are required to attend school shall be one week prior to Labor Day.
